summaryrefslogtreecommitdiffstats
path: root/Objects/bytes_methods.c
Commit message (Expand)AuthorAgeFilesLines
* gh-84436: Implement Immortal Objects (gh-19474)Eddie Elizondo2023-04-221-3/+6
* gh-102941: Fix "‘subobj’ may be used uninitialized in this function" warn...Nikita Sobolev2023-03-271-1/+1
* gh-93033: Use wmemchr in stringlib (GH-93034)goldsteinn2022-05-241-0/+1
* bpo-43179: Generalise alignment for optimised string routines (GH-24624)Jessica Clarke2021-03-311-3/+2
* bpo-38252: Use 8-byte step to detect ASCII sequence in 64bit Windows build (G...Ma Lin2020-10-181-10/+10
* bpo-40170: Add _PyIndex_Check() internal function (GH-19426)Victor Stinner2020-04-081-1/+2
* bpo-35081: Move bytes_methods.h to the internal C API (GH-18492)Victor Stinner2020-02-121-1/+1
* closes bpo-39605: Fix some casts to not cast away const. (GH-18453)Andy Lester2020-02-121-8/+8
* bpo-38383: Fix possible integer overflow in startswith() of bytes and bytearr...Hai Shi2019-10-061-1/+1
* closes bpo-34599: Improve performance of _Py_bytes_capitalize(). (GH-9083)Sergey Fedoseev2018-09-071-17/+3
* bpo-20180: complete AC conversion of Objects/stringlib/transmogrify.h (GH-8039)Tal Einat2018-07-061-30/+0
* bpo-32677: Optimize str.isascii() (GH-5356)INADA Naoki2018-01-281-4/+36
* bpo-32677: Add .isascii() to str, bytes and bytearray (GH-5342)INADA Naoki2018-01-271-0/+20
* bpo-29549: Fixes docstring for str.index (#256)Lisa Roach2017-04-051-3/+10
* bpo-29730: replace some calls to PyNumber_Check and improve some error messag...Oren Milman2017-03-121-15/+19
* remove all usage of Py_LOCALBenjamin Peterson2016-09-091-2/+2
* Issue #27474: Unified error messages in the __contains__ method of bytes andSerhiy Storchaka2016-07-101-1/+1
* Issue #26765: Fixed parsing Py_ssize_t arguments on 32-bit Windows.Serhiy Storchaka2016-07-031-0/+1
* Issue #26765: Moved common code and docstrings for bytes and bytearray methodsSerhiy Storchaka2016-05-041-0/+424
* Issue #25923: Added more const qualifiers to signatures of static and private...Serhiy Storchaka2015-12-251-3/+3
* Issue #22896: Avoid to use PyObject_AsCharBuffer(), PyObject_AsReadBuffer()Serhiy Storchaka2015-02-021-39/+7
|\
| * Issue #22896: Avoid to use PyObject_AsCharBuffer(), PyObject_AsReadBuffer()Serhiy Storchaka2015-02-021-27/+6
* | #16518: Bring error messages in harmony with docs ("bytes-like object")R David Murray2014-10-051-1/+1
* | Issue #20179: Apply Argument Clinic to bytes and bytearray.Martin v. Löwis2014-07-271-4/+2
|/
* Issue #18722: Remove uses of the "register" keyword in C code.Antoine Pitrou2013-08-131-15/+15
* Issue #13738: Simplify implementation of bytes.lower() and bytes.upper().Antoine Pitrou2012-01-081-10/+2
* Fix closes Issue12385 - Clarify maketrans method docstring for bytes and byte...Senthil Kumaran2011-06-271-4/+4
* Fix (harmless) warning with MSVC.Antoine Pitrou2010-08-151-1/+1
* Fix indentation and remove dead code.Antoine Pitrou2010-08-151-132/+98
* Fix the docstrings of the capitalize method.Senthil Kumaran2010-07-051-1/+2
* Recorded merge of revisions 81029 via svnmerge fromAntoine Pitrou2010-05-091-157/+157
* Issue #7065: Fix a crash in bytes.maketrans and bytearray.maketrans whenAntoine Pitrou2009-10-141-2/+2
* Merged revisions 72040 via svnmerge fromEric Smith2009-04-271-246/+33
* Add bytes/bytearray.maketrans() to mirror str.maketrans(), and deprecateGeorg Brandl2009-04-121-0/+67
* Renamed PyString to PyBytesChristian Heimes2008-05-261-10/+10
* For PEP3137: Adds missing methods to the mutable PyBytes object (soonGregory P. Smith2007-10-161-0/+610
905bcf3f3009f71cfa70525eb8b0ad3dc'>bdb.py20143logstatsplain -rw-r--r--binhex.py15023logstatsplain -rw-r--r--bisect.py2394logstatsplain d---------bsddb293logstatsplain -rwxr-xr-xcProfile.py6259logstatsplain -rw-r--r--calendar.py22987logstatsplain -rwxr-xr-xcgi.py35187logstatsplain -rw-r--r--cgitb.py12087logstatsplain -rw-r--r--chunk.py5372logstatsplain -rw-r--r--cmd.py14962logstatsplain -rw-r--r--code.py9968logstatsplain -rw-r--r--codecs.py33297logstatsplain -rw-r--r--codeop.py5999logstatsplain -rw-r--r--collections.py2297logstatsplain -rw-r--r--colorsys.py3459logstatsplain -rw-r--r--commands.py2375logstatsplain -rw-r--r--compileall.py5283logstatsplain d---------compiler415logstatsplain -rw-r--r--contextlib.py4105logstatsplain -rw-r--r--cookielib.py64520logstatsplain -rw-r--r--copy.py10943logstatsplain -rw-r--r--copy_reg.py6778logstatsplain -rw-r--r--csv.py15188logstatsplain d---------ctypes217logstatsplain d---------curses225logstatsplain -rw-r--r--dbhash.py404logstatsplain -rw-r--r--decimal.py107841logstatsplain -rw-r--r--difflib.py80784logstatsplain -rw-r--r--dircache.py1006logstatsplain -rw-r--r--dis.py6484logstatsplain d---------distutils1173logstatsplain -rw-r--r--doctest.py98930logstatsplain -rw-r--r--dumbdbm.py8820logstatsplain -rw-r--r--dummy_thread.py4511logstatsplain -rw-r--r--dummy_threading.py2804logstatsplain d---------email607logstatsplain d---------encodings4479logstatsplain -rw-r--r--filecmp.py9471logstatsplain -rw-r--r--fileinput.py14132logstatsplain -rw-r--r--fnmatch.py3019logstatsplain -rw-r--r--formatter.py14954logstatsplain -rw-r--r--fpformat.py4579logstatsplain -rw-r--r--ftplib.py27445logstatsplain -rw-r--r--functools.py2154logstatsplain -rw-r--r--genericpath.py3051logstatsplain -rw-r--r--getopt.py7316logstatsplain -rw-r--r--getpass.py3362logstatsplain -rw-r--r--gettext.py19890logstatsplain -rw-r--r--glob.py2230logstatsplain -rw-r--r--gopherlib.py5709logstatsplain -rw-r--r--gzip.py17352logstatsplain -rw-r--r--hashlib.py4834logstatsplain -rw-r--r--heapq.py15474logstatsplain -rw-r--r--hmac.py3761logstatsplain d---------hotshot146logstatsplain -rw-r--r--htmlentitydefs.py18054logstatsplain -rw-r--r--htmllib.py12740logstatsplain -rw-r--r--httplib.py47309logstatsplain d---------idlelib3039logstatsplain -rw-r--r--ihooks.py17335logstatsplain -rw-r--r--imaplib.py46805logstatsplain -rw-r--r--imghdr.py3538logstatsplain -rw-r--r--imputil.py25872logstatsplain -rw-r--r--inspect.py35722logstatsplain -rwxr-xr-xkeyword.py2043logstatsplain d---------lib-tk682logstatsplain -rw-r--r--linecache.py4070logstatsplain -rw-r--r--locale.py73052logstatsplain d---------logging115logstatsplain -rw-r--r--macpath.py5951logstatsplain -rw-r--r--macurl2path.py3275logstatsplain -rwxr-xr-xmailbox.py75359logstatsplain -rw-r--r--mailcap.py7427logstatsplain -rw-r--r--markupbase.py14350logstatsplain -rw-r--r--md5.py241logstatsplain -rw-r--r--mhlib.py33270logstatsplain -rw-r--r--mimetools.py6841logstatsplain -rw-r--r--mimetypes.py18690logstatsplain -rwxr-xr-xmimify.py14885logstatsplain -rw-r--r--modulefinder.py24179logstatsplain d---------msilib150logstatsplain -rw-r--r--multifile.py4677logstatsplain -rw-r--r--mutex.py1749logstatsplain -rw-r--r--netrc.py4111logstatsplain -rw-r--r--new.py541logstatsplain -rw-r--r--nntplib.py21196logstatsplain -rw-r--r--ntpath.py16975logstatsplain -rw-r--r--nturl2path.py2239logstatsplain -rw-r--r--opcode.py5210logstatsplain -rw-r--r--optparse.py60250logstatsplain -rw-r--r--os.py24912logstatsplain -rw-r--r--os2emxpath.py4498logstatsplain -rw-r--r--pdb.doc7749logstatsplain -rwxr-xr-xpdb.py43493logstatsplain -rw-r--r--pickle.py44792logstatsplain -rw-r--r--pickletools.py73421logstatsplain -rw-r--r--pipes.py9984logstatsplain -rw-r--r--pkgutil.py18491logstatsplain d---------plat-aix366logstatsplain d---------plat-aix466logstatsplain d---------plat-atheos102logstatsplain d---------plat-beos566logstatsplain d---------plat-darwin66logstatsplain d---------plat-freebsd266logstatsplain d---------plat-freebsd366logstatsplain d---------plat-freebsd466logstatsplain d---------plat-freebsd566logstatsplain d---------plat-freebsd666logstatsplain d---------plat-freebsd766logstatsplain d---------plat-generic33logstatsplain d---------plat-irix5916logstatsplain d---------plat-irix6879logstatsplain d---------plat-linux2174logstatsplain d---------plat-mac1295logstatsplain d---------plat-netbsd166logstatsplain d---------plat-next333logstatsplain d---------plat-os2emx211logstatsplain d---------plat-riscos126logstatsplain d---------plat-sunos5253logstatsplain d---------plat-unixware7104logstatsplain -rwxr-xr-xplatform.py48124logstatsplain -rw-r--r--popen2.py8367logstatsplain -rw-r--r--poplib.py11952logstatsplain -rw-r--r--posixfile.py7843logstatsplain -rw-r--r--posixpath.py12529logstatsplain -rw-r--r--pprint.py10878logstatsplain -rwxr-xr-xprofile.py23513logstatsplain -rw-r--r--pstats.py25940logstatsplain -rw-r--r--pty.py4869logstatsplain -rw-r--r--py_compile.py5518logstatsplain -rw-r--r--pyclbr.py13279logstatsplain -rwxr-xr-xpydoc.py90703logstatsplain -rwxr-xr-xquopri.py6969logstatsplain -rw-r--r--random.py30486logstatsplain -rw-r--r--re.py12232logstatsplain -rw-r--r--repr.py3976logstatsplain -rw-r--r--rexec.py20035logstatsplain -rw-r--r--rfc822.py33167logstatsplain -rw-r--r--rlcompleter.py5309logstatsplain -rw-r--r--robotparser.py9909logstatsplain -rwxr-xr-xrunpy.py3577logstatsplain -rw-r--r--sched.py4535logstatsplain -rw-r--r--sets.py19738logstatsplain -rw-r--r--sgmllib.py17772logstatsplain -rw-r--r--sha.py265logstatsplain -rw-r--r--shelve.py7565logstatsplain -rw-r--r--shlex.py11124logstatsplain -rw-r--r--shutil.py6060logstatsplain d---------site-packages34logstatsplain -rw-r--r--site.py14436logstatsplain -rwxr-xr-xsmtpd.py18016logstatsplain -rwxr-xr-xsmtplib.py29243logstatsplain -rw-r--r--sndhdr.py5971logstatsplain -rw-r--r--socket.py14196logstatsplain d---------sqlite3107logstatsplain -rw-r--r--sre.py384logstatsplain -rw-r--r--sre_compile.py16500logstatsplain -rw-r--r--sre_constants.py7137logstatsplain -rw-r--r--sre_parse.py26982logstatsplain -rw-r--r--stat.py1952logstatsplain -rw-r--r--statvfs.py779logstatsplain -rw-r--r--string.py16692logstatsplain -rw-r--r--stringold.py12333logstatsplain -rw-r--r--stringprep.py13522logstatsplain -rw-r--r--struct.py2970logstatsplain -rw-r--r--subprocess.py43852logstatsplain -rw-r--r--sunau.py16515logstatsplain -rw-r--r--sunaudio.py1236logstatsplain -rwxr-xr-xsymbol.py2031logstatsplain -rw-r--r--symtable.py7710logstatsplain -rwxr-xr-xtabnanny.py11336logstatsplain -rw-r--r--tarfile.py85164logstatsplain -rw-r--r--telnetlib.py21771logstatsplain -rw-r--r--tempfile.py17219logstatsplain d---------test17199logstatsplain -rw-r--r--textwrap.py15069logstatsplain